Output 65df540ac7805b26f2ce8c7adc2b1f2a50f6e735f80522a09c072684ad08eb78:0

value
152000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2dd61ee860fe31fde3cc4906eb3f19d7d8cf5de OP_EQUAL
address
3Luy2ks6wiHVHFDmvVscWcPCfC3mGJtBZr
transaction
65df540ac7805b26f2ce8c7adc2b1f2a50f6e735f80522a09c072684ad08eb78
spent
true